Location and Weather Enter a college, major, state, city, GPA or SAT/ACT score, U.S. Department of Education National Center for Education Statistics, Boston University is larger than than BC based on total student enrollment (36,104 students vs. 15,577 students), Boston College is 3.4% more expensive to attend than BU for in-state tuition ($60,530.00 vs. $58,560.00), Out of state tuition is 3.4% higher at BC than Boston University ($60,530.00 vs. $58,560.00), The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Boston University than BC ($29,154 vs. $30,192),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Boston College are 7.9% lower than costs at Boston University ($15,602 vs. $16,840), More students receive financial grant aid at Boston University than Boston College (52% vs. 51%), The average total grant financial aid received by Boston College students is 1.2% larger than aid received Boston University ($46,258 vs. $45,724), The average SAT score at Boston College (1380) is 77 points higher than at BU (1303), Incoming BC students have a 3 point higher average ACT score (32) than students at BU (29), Accepted freshman BC students have a 0.07 point higher average high school GPA (3.86) than students at BU (3.79), BC has a higher acceptance rate (19%) than BU (18.6%), The graduation rate at BC is higher than Boston University (91% vs. 85%), Graduates from Boston College earn on average $18,900 more per year than BU graduates after ten years. U.S. News & World Report for 2019 ranked numerous BU graduate programs among the countrys top 50: Sargent Colleges occupational therapy program (#1), School of Public Healths program (#10), Business (#42), Education (#34), Law (#22), Engineering (#34), Biomedical Engineering (#12), Medical Research (#29), Medical Primary Care (#26), Social Work (#10), as well as graduate programs in Computer Science, Math, Physics, Economics, Psychology, and Sociology.
